- The distance between Chugwater, Wy, Usa and Jackson, Ms, Usa is approximately 1,701 km or 1,057 mi.
- To reach Chugwater, Wy in this distance one would set out from Jackson, Ms bearing 313.5°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Chugwater, Wy bearing 304.4° or NW .
- Chugwater, Wy has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Jackson, Ms has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Chugwater, Wy is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Jackson, Ms is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 9.7 °C (17.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.5 °C (4.5°F) more in Chugwater, Wy.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1009.2 mm (39.7 in) less which is equivalent to 1009.2 l/m² (24.77 US gal/ft²) or 10,092,000 l/ha (1,078,902 US gal/ac) less. About 2/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.7° lower in Chugwater, Wy than in Jackson, Ms.
